It's been a year since we lost our dear Riley.  I miss her terribly, and I'm sure I always will.  She had a good quality of life after her amputation, and lived 19 months as a tripod.  In retrospect, it was the right decision for her.  Although her cancer never returned, realistically, fourteen years was a decent life span for a larger dog.  It just wasn't enough.  Double that wouldn't have been enough, though.  

I suppose that I will note the anniversary of losing her every year.  Does anybody ever forget?  This has been a very rough year.  Losing your second favorite person in the world - who wasn't even a person - has been just as hard as I thought it would be.  There's no getting over a loss of this magnitude, it just dulls a little.

I am grateful to this website for all the information and support provided when I need it .  Thanks to all.
